Bear Valley Village rests at 7,000′ on the west slope of the Sierra Nevada. Spectacular Bear Valley winters (boasting a 30 foot avg. annual snowfall) are followed by sensational summers, offering abundant outdoor adventure, annual music festivals, fishing, camping, exciting special events and a comfortable mountain climate.
Upon entering the quaint mountain village, visitors encounter a unique atmosphere far different from typical tourist areas. Bear Valley is home to a variety of shops, services, cabins, condominiums and mountain properties, not to mention clear mountain air, rivers, lakes & streams, towering pine trees and dramatic vistas in all directions. Located throughout the friendly walking village are a variety of sports, clothing, & gift shops, restaurants and lodges/hotels. Equipment, guide services and information for nearly every type of outdoor activity are available year ’round for rent or sale in Bear Valley Village.
